Output d28073e7c6bdbcd1f23d69754341e07630a40662139c3a47854def199cef7e0a:62

value
852000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 286fc321691c2b62c2c174d5ce75a2b8c30ed400 OP_EQUAL
address
35NpqbLFfhzFpvUCjRJxtSeVsn8Hoa3YVj
transaction
d28073e7c6bdbcd1f23d69754341e07630a40662139c3a47854def199cef7e0a